We are looking for an ambitious and passionate Trial Lawyer to join our growing team. As a Trial Lawyer at our firm, you will work alongside a dynamic and experienced team of Attorneys across the nation, and have local and remote support staff. A typical day for an Attorney at Altman Nussbaum Shunnarah Trial Attorneys involves client communication, taking and defending depositions, research and drafting, leading mediations, developing case strategies, and taking cases to trial. Our Trial Lawyers handle cases from intake through settlement or jury verdict.
